How much does it cost to rent a home in Shubert?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Shubert 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,018 | $650 | $1,600 |
Shubert 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,299 | $750 | $1,850 |
Shubert 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,071 | $1,500 | $2,500 |
Shubert 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,025 | $1,550 | $2,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Shubert
What type of rentals are currently available in Shubert?
There are currently 49 Apartments for Rent in Shubert, NE with pricing that ranges from $625 to $10,096. There are also 38 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Shubert ranging from $560 to $2,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Shubert?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Shubert ranges from $560 to $2,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,425.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Shubert?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Shubert range from $825 to $2,275,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$750 to $1,850.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,500 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$925.
